Abstract

148,314. Huth Ges., Dr. E. F. March 30, 1918, [Convention date]. High vacua in lamp bulbs, obtaining and maintaining.-During exhaustion of a vacuum tube, small quantities of gas or vapour, such as ether or other volatile hydrocarbon, are admitted to the tube, the filament being heated, as the exhaustion proceeds. It is stated that by this means the current between the filament and the anode is largely increased both before and after the exhaustion has been completed, thereby facilitating electron bombardment of the anode, and providing a larger current during normal working.
